在现代软件开发中,GitHub作为一个重要的开源平台,承载了无数项目与代码。用户在GitHub上的活跃度通常通过一个简单的符号来体现,那就是绿色对号。本文将深入探讨这一标志的意义、如何获取它以及它对开源项目的影响。
绿色对号的定义
绿色对号是GitHub为用户的贡献行为提供的一种视觉反馈。通常,这些绿色的标记表示用户在特定时间段内对项目的贡献。每一个绿色的方块都代表着用户在该日提交的代码数量,越深的绿色代表着贡献越多。
为什么绿色对号重要?
绿色对号不仅仅是一个简单的视觉元素,它在多个方面对开发者及其项目都有重要意义:
- 激励作用:看到自己的绿色对号逐渐增加,会激励开发者更加活跃地参与开源项目。
- 声望象征:活跃的贡献者通常在开发社区中享有更高的声望。
- 项目吸引力:对于开源项目来说,看到多个绿色对号也能吸引更多的贡献者。
如何获得GitHub绿色对号
获得绿色对号并不难,以下是一些基本的步骤:
- 创建一个GitHub账号:注册一个GitHub账号,成为平台的正式用户。
- 选择开源项目:选择你感兴趣的开源项目,查看其问题(Issues)或者需求(Pull Requests)。
- 提交代码:在本地修改代码后,通过Git提交更改,确保你每天都有至少一次提交。
- 持续贡献:为了获得更多的绿色对号,建议持续进行代码提交,甚至参与到多个项目中。
绿色对号的计算方法
GitHub的绿色对号是基于用户提交代码的数量来计算的:
- 每天至少一次提交将显示一个绿色方块。
- 每增加一次提交,绿色的深度将增加,最多为七种不同的绿色深度。
- 你可以在GitHub主页的贡献图上查看自己的贡献记录。
绿色对号的相关误区
很多新手开发者对绿色对号存在误解,以下是常见的误区:
- 误区一:提交次数越多,绿色对号就越多。
- 其实,质量与频率同样重要,重复提交同一内容并不算作有效贡献。
- 误区二:只有提交代码才能获得绿色对号。
- 实际上,参与文档编写、解决问题、进行代码审核等也可以获得贡献。
绿色对号的影响
绿色对号在开源项目及开发者个人方面都有显著影响:
- 提升项目活跃度:绿色对号可以吸引其他开发者关注该项目,提升项目的知名度与活跃度。
- 促进个人成长:通过积累绿色对号,开发者可以提升自己的编程能力和项目管理能力。
常见问题解答(FAQ)
绿色对号每个颜色代表什么?
绿色对号的颜色深浅代表着贡献的数量,越深的绿色表示该日的贡献越多。具体来说,浅绿色代表少量贡献,深绿色代表大量贡献。
我可以通过什么方式获取更多的绿色对号?
你可以通过参与多个开源项目,保持代码提交的频率和质量,解决Issues和Review Pull Requests等方式获取更多的绿色对号。
绿色对号会过期吗?
GitHub不会对绿色对号进行清除,但你每天的贡献会在GitHub的贡献图上更新。如果你在某天没有提交,那个日期的方块将不再显示。
绿色对号会影响我的职业发展吗?
是的,活跃的贡献者在求职时通常会受到更多关注,尤其是技术公司更倾向于聘请在开源社区有一定贡献的人。
如何查看我的绿色对号记录?
你可以在GitHub主页上点击你的头像,进入个人资料页面,向下滚动可以看到你的贡献图,那里显示了你每天的提交情况及绿色对号的分布。
通过以上的信息,我们希望能帮助更多的开发者理解GitHub的绿色对号,进而更好地参与到开源项目中去。无论是为自己的职业发展还是为开源社区的繁荣,积极的贡献都将带来不可估量的回报。